支持大规模视频融合的混合现实技术

[摘要] 视频融合是视频监测控制相关应用领域关注的虚拟现实(VR)热点问题之一。根据实现虚实融合的维度不同,将相关研究方法分为4类:视频标签地图、视频图像拼接、视频叠加到三维场景、视频融合到三维场景。介绍了VR视频融合技术方面的相关工作,认为虚实融合技术正在快速发展中,虚实信息的可视关联对于人类认知和人工智能都已表现出显著的提升作用,未来将可能作为一种基础的地理信息资源来提供,有着重要的应用价值。

[Abstract] Video fusion is a hot topic in some virtual reality (VR) application areas such as video surveillance. According to dimension number, related works in virtual-reality integration are surveyed in this paper in four categories: map with video tag, video image stitching, video overlapping on 3D scenes, and the video fusion in 3D scenes. Then our work in VR video fusion is presented in this paper, especially the new idea of video model and mixed reality rendering. The virtual reality technology is developing rapidly, and the visual correlation of the virtual and real environments has shown significant improvement on both human cognition and artificial intelligence. In the future, the video model may be provided as a fundamental geographic layer resource, which has significant values for various applications.
